Why Should You Enroll In an Online MRI Tech School?

MRI Certification Programs

Only selected health practitioners can enroll in an MRI tech school. MRI stands for Magnetic Resonance Imaging, and MRI technologists are health professionals who are well-trained in preparing and positioning patients for an MRI procedure. They gather diagnostic images of the organs inside the patient’s body using the MRI scanner.

Although most of the MRI technician’s work is concentrated on operating the MRI machine, it is also their job to speak to patients and ensure they’re comfortable with the procedure. They should also take useful 3D images so physicians and radiologists can use them to correctly diagnose the patient’s illness.

What to Know Before Applying to an MRI Tech School

While an MRI technologist’s career path and salary package are very promising, not everyone can become an MRI technician. Each online MRI tech school imposes minimum enrollment requirements that every aspiring student needs to meet. Some schools require an associate’s degree in a related radiology course.

If the training slots are rather limited and the school is forced to choose only a handful of students from many applicants, then they will pick those with more biology, physics, and chemistry units. They may also prefer students with first aid and CPR training and those who are very involved in the health outreach programs in their communities.

How to Become a Certified MRI Tech

Each MRI tech program may be different, so it’s very important that you choose an MRI tech school that is accredited by the ARRT. There are programs that are designed for students who merely hold a GED or high school diploma, and this type of program could take anywhere from three to five years. Those with an associate’s degree in a different field may spend two to three years learning MRI. But, those who already hold a license with the ARRT as a radiologist or a similar profession most likely need only a year of training to become an MRI technologist.

However, completing the MRI tech program won’t automatically make you a certified MRI technologist. You also have to undergo clinical training, which is a requirement of the ARRT, to give you a seat on the MRI certification exam. Once you have completed all the required educational credits and logged in the minimum clinical training hours, you’ll be eligible to take the certification exam to eventually become a licensed MRI technologist.
